// Sensor drift handling for the Verdance greenhouse controller.
// The humidity probes wander after about six weeks in the misting
// bays, so we re-baseline against the reference sensor on a schedule
// instead of trusting raw readings. Support folks: if growers report
// phantom vent cycling, drift compensation is the usual suspect.
// The calibration knobs we currently ship with are listed here.

limits module of tafop-hahop:
WEIGHTS = {
    "julmir": 223,
    "belox": 987,
    "lamion": 470,
    "pelath": 609,
    "fraok": 1010,
    "eliion": 343,
    "drudor": 342,
}

Step 4 — Enable dark mode on the Corvette Admin Dashboard. Flip THEME_DARK_ENABLED=true in the env file and redeploy the frontend pod; no database migration needed. Heads up: the palette assets come from our theming service, so if icons look washed out, clear the CDN cache before panicking. The dashboard authenticates to the theming service with a token it reads at startup. Add that token on the line right after this step.

vault entry, fadup-baguf: VAULT_KEY3=0e7

### Runbook: Sensor drift — Verdana Greenhouse Controller

If humidity readings start wandering more than 5% from the reference probe, the Verdana controller needs a recalibration push. Don't panic — it happens most seasons. SSH into the control node, run `verdctl drift-check`, then post the correction via the CalibHub internal API. To authenticate against CalibHub, use the key below.

gateway credential: qvz15-KH6w5OvQFD1Z8FT

TURN-208: Gatevale turnstile counters at the Merrow Field pilot double-count when a rotation reverses mid-cycle. Attendance totals drift roughly 2% high per event. The debounce window fix is implemented, reviewed by Ilsa, and soak-tested across two simulated match days without drift. Ready for your cut; the candidate build is identified below.

trace token, tagag-tafog: htk6_5ed18c